John Frecke Obituary

Frecke, John age 73, Veteran US Army, loving father of Dawn (Kenny) Kozlowski, Tammy, Pam (John) Nickels, John (Bobbi), and Josephine (Eddie) Humphrey, fond companion to Patricia, proud grandfather of nine, fond brother of many, dear uncle of many nieces and nephews, and a cherished friend of many. In lieu of flowers, donations can be given to Southern Care Hospice, 310 W. McKinley, Suite 340, Mishawaka, IN 46545. Funeral Monday, 10:00 a.m. at Root Funeral Home, 312 E. 7th St., Michigan City, IN. Interment Pine Lake Cemetery, La Porte, IN. Visitation Sunday, 2:00 to 8:00 p.m. 219-874-6209
